Output 10f8ddbc4349a9c8fdec92d0363d63664222f3eeaac5e3539cf9eeea36b7cb84:0

value
506370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43e156d12c1dc05f0e4605bc2a0b93d1f51d0daa OP_EQUAL
address
37sw9EVzVN4wXvSYVKQLGP6ZCxNWiZeYgG
transaction
10f8ddbc4349a9c8fdec92d0363d63664222f3eeaac5e3539cf9eeea36b7cb84
spent
true